FORESTRY and Land Scotland (FLS) is taking part in a free ‘Meet the Buyer South’ event being staged at Hampden Park, Glasgow on Wednesday 13 November.

Organised by the Supplier Development Programme, in partnership with Scottish Government and Highlands and Scotland Excel, the event offers businesses in the south of Scotland an unparalleled opportunity to speak directly to a wide range of purchasers and decision-makers.

FLS procurent manager, Dorothy Low, said: “This is a great way for businesses to find out what opportunities FLS offers and to have chat with us about how they should go about taking advantage of those opportunities.

“£11 billion is spent in the public sector in Scotland each year on goods, services and works and this event will be an ideal opportunity for businesses, especially small ones to find out more about bidding for public sector work.

“This is a great way to test the water, speak to the experts and get some good advice and guidance on working with the public sector.”

The free event will bring together buyers from the public sector, including Scottish local authorities, NHS Scotland, Scottish Government bodies, the construction and transport sectors and many more.

There will also be several large private contractors exhibiting that are keen to engage with new suppliers and promote their sub-contract opportunities.
